i will review it and get back to you soon vs i will review it and get back to you shortly

Both phrases are correct and commonly used in English. They convey the same meaning of reviewing something and getting back to the person soon. The choice between 'soon' and 'shortly' is a matter of personal preference or style, as both are appropriate in this context.
